    But then The day went down hill with not just rain, but this....
    Which is now gracing its ram'ness in my driveway...







    Yes that is a Dodge Caliber.
    It is so plain and blah.
    The 2.0L is something to be desired, oh so little power....
    The auto trans is so weird, I can't feel the shift points, and there is only one gear pass drive which is Low.
    The dash is so plain, the base model corolla has more bells and whistles than this thing.
    It has the feel of and SUV in the seating, yet is a car.
    The dash has no tach, and I don't like that, I am just use to a tach.
    The stereo system is also something to be desired. A stock 3rd gen system in a 97' sounds better than this thing.
    And the blind spots, MY GOD THE BLIND SPOTS!
    So that is my car & driver review of the Dodge.
